Jamal Khashoggi (* October 13, 1958 in Medina; † October 2, 2018 in Consulate General of Saudi Arabia in Istanbul) was a saudi journalist. He was 59 years old. He was married to Rawia Khashoggi and Hatice Cengiz. He had 4 children. His education included Indiana State University, Indiana University and Victoria College. His faith was Sunni Islam. He received a total of 1 awards. His cause of death was killing.
